Which is greater: 0.406 or 0.46? Use >, <, or = and explain why.
0.406 < 0.46
Possible Explaination (0.406 = 0.406; 0.46 = 0.460; 460 > 406)

Here are five pencil lengths in inches: 2, 3, 2, 4, 3. What is the mode? What is the range?
Mode: 2 and 3 (both appear twice; they both occur the most often).
Range: 4 − 2 = 2 inches (subtract the lowest value from the highest value).
Given the following coordinate pair, (3, 2), which number tells you how far to go right? Which tells you how far to go up?
3 = go right (x-axis);
2 = go up (y-axis)
(Remember: run before you rise. Move the ladder, then climb the ladder)

Multiply 12.3 × 10. Then multiply 12.3 × 100. What pattern do you notice with the decimal point?
12.3 × 10 = 123
12.3 × 100 = 1,230
The decimal moves right one place for each zero.

A bag of apples weighs 4.8 pounds. If each apple weighs about 0.3 pounds, about how many apples are in the bag?
4.8 ÷ 0.3 = 16 apples
(multiply both by 10 to get rid of the decimal in the divisor: 48 ÷ 3 = 16)
You have 3 1/2 pizzas. Each person gets 1/4 of a pizza. How many people can you feed? Show your work dividing a whole number by a unit fraction.
3 1/2 ÷ 1/4 = 7/2 ÷ 1/4 = 7/2 × 4/1 = 28/2 = 14 people
(Remember: keep, change, flip)
You have a ribbon that is 2.5 meters long. You want to cut it into pieces that are each 25 centimeters long. How many pieces can you cut? Show all your unit conversions.
2.5 m = 250 cm. 250 ÷ 25 = 10 pieces.
